Power plant

Xingu1: 2 x 680 SHP PWC PT6A-28 turboprops with 3 blade propellers. Xingu2: 2 x 850 SHP PWC PT6A-42 turboprops with 4 blade propellers.

Accommodation

One or two pilots and 5 (Xingu 2: 8) passengers.

Notes

Liaison and trainer aircraft. In service since 1977. Coupled EMB-110 Bandeirante wings and engines with a new fuselage. The major customer was the French Armée de LAir. Several derivations, including the EMB-120 Brasilia as regional airliner and the EMB-123 Tapajas. Last development EMB-121B Xingu 2 with more powerful engines, more seat capacity, stretched fuselage and wing span. Production ceased in 1987 after 105 aircraft were built. EMB-121B Xingu 2: Wing span 14,83 m MTOW 6140 kg.
